Overview

The Assembler position at Snap-on involves the construction of mechanical subassemblies or entire units using light powered electrical or mechanical tools. The role requires performing repetitive manual operations and maintaining a safe work environment, with a work schedule from Monday to Friday and occasional overtime.

Responsibilities

  • Assembly of some or all product lines using both manual and mechanical means
  • Capable of calibrating, building, and finaling
  • Capable of laser set up and operations
  • Maintaining a safe work environment

Requirements

  • High school diploma, GED or minimum one-year equivalent manufacturing experience
  • Soldering and assembly experience strongly preferred
  • Must be literate and fluent in English; able to read, write and speak
  • Excellent manual dexterity
  • Ability to prioritize and adjust in a fast-paced manufacturing work environment
  • Motivated with the ability to work independently and with the team
  • Very strong organizational skills
  • Ability to train colleagues, new hires and temporary staff
  • Ability to prioritize and focus on details with attention to accuracy and deadlines
